Transaction 179c1f76f8e8a0f26faff5f2b8461c9bb9d14c318eae567b74454c8857067ef7
1 Input
1 Output
-
179c1f76f8e8a0f26faff5f2b8461c9bb9d14c318eae567b74454c8857067ef7:0
- value
- 2434888
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77bc6ee993eec2e345b7197d75d4947826c1af47 OP_EQUAL
- address
- 3Cc84wfw358j2yVJMEuxp9dhN5sQtQaba8